consulby
Find a Consulate or Embassy in the United Kingdom (change country)

Latvian Embassy in Kilkerran South Ayrshire > Scotland > United Kingdom




Latvian Embassy in Kilkerran
The fastest and most efficient technique to resolve any problems with your visa or passport when you're in Kilkerran and go back to your country is without having doubt contact the nearest Latvian Embassy in Kilkerran

Contact us in case you know any Latvian Embassy in Kilkerran not appear in this page or if you know of any other consular office in the same country that is definitely located in Kilkerran or in nearby towns. 

We struggled quite put in a single database all embassies, consulates and offices close representation Kilkerran but eventually we produced it. Then check out all of the offices that we have located and ordered by proximity. The vast majority of our users resort to higher FINDER to quickly locate the diplomatic mission or consular office which is closest to your current location.








Nearest Latvian Embassy in Kilkerran, found 1